Job Summary
We are seeking an energetic and self motivated team member for Packaging Development. Your role involves new launch and lifecycle management of Injectable products. Also the role demands execution of projects driven by packaging development.
Roles & Responsibilities
The role involves managing new product launches and lifecycle management across all markets. Key responsibilities include:
Core area:
- Maintain Design History File for combination products for its lifecycle management.
- Prepare Design History File for site transfer of combination products.
- Get involved in design verification phase of combination product development and contribute.
- Handle market complaints and create investigation report to find out root cause and appropriate CAPA.
- Create awareness of combination product requirement across cross functional team.
- Create process to streamline the activities related to combination product development.
- Get involved in designing of assembly line and packing lines and contribute to design the machine.
- Contribute in threshold analysis during site transfer of products.
- Productivity Improvement: Lead productivity improvement projects within the plant.
- Quality Management System (QMS): Monitor and control QMS-related goals for the plant.
- Technical Support: Provide technical input for generating keyline drawings of printed packaging components.
- Regulatory Knowledge: Ensure compliance with regulatory requirements for artwork creation across different markets.
- Change Control Process: Understand and manage the change control process, including raising notifications in SAP and following up for approval.
- SDP & Cost Saving Projects: Execute SDP-related projects and drive cost-saving initiatives.
- Issue Resolution: Attend to and resolve issues in the production area.
Educational qualification: Post-Graduation in Packaging Technology or equivalent, Experience in device development and combination product design history file will be preferred.
Minimum work experience: 3-8 years of experience in device development

About the Department
Global Manufacturing Organisation (GMO)
At Dr. Reddy's Laboratories, we are dedicated to making a meaningful impact on global healthcare through precision manufacturing and innovation. With a legacy of excellence, we are a leading force in the pharmaceutical industry.
We operate 19 state-of-the-art manufacturing plants across Hyderabad, Vizag, Baddi, Mexico, Shreveport, and Mirfield, comprising 8 OSD facilities, 3 Injectables facilities, and 8 API facilities.
Benchmarking manufacturing processes and continuous operational excellence are at the core of our capability to deliver quality medicines to our patients in 66 countries. We manufacture a portfolio of complex APIs and 1,150+ drug master files across key therapy areas such as Oncology, Cardio-vascular, Central Nervous System and Anti-Diabetes. he World Economic Forum has recognised our largest manufacturing facility in Bachupally, Hyderabad, as part of its Global Lighthouse Network.
